Output 3fafc067de85e718c4946809848066b0abe94dca0fbdba2b856bef4f1b4fed2a:1

value
7618921205
script pubkey
OP_0 OP_PUSHBYTES_20 b6abf129bdd25f61ae60a21e05eab4d2ea5a191c
address
ltc1qk64lz2da6f0krtnq5g0qt6456t495xguvntcwq
transaction
3fafc067de85e718c4946809848066b0abe94dca0fbdba2b856bef4f1b4fed2a
spent
true